Elemental Hair Analysis: An Overview of Preparation Procedures and Applications

Trace element hair analysis has gained increased attention since human scalp hair became widely used as a biomarker of environmental and occupational exposure. Nowadays, hair analysis has found many more applications in toxicological, clinical, nutritional, or forensic sciences and is becoming more and more popular, reliable, and widespread. In this chapter, the brief history of the utility of human hair is presented. The next sections will cover topics such as hair structure, growth phases, sampling protocol, washing procedures, and decomposition methods. Further, some evident advantages of elemental hair analysis over urine and blood studies are discussed, and some apparent limitations of hair surveys are also listed. Hair elemental analysis is reviewed in this chapter in the context of the influence of the selected factors on the accuracy and credibility of the gathered results. Finally, the information about some general recommendations regarding elemental hair analysis is provided in the summary section.
